STM32F101R4T6A - STMicroelectronics
The STM32F101R4T6A microcontroller from STMicroelectronics is part of the STM32F1 series, designed to offer a balance of performance, power efficiency, and peripherals for a wide range of applications. This device is built on the high-performance ARM® Cortex®-M3 32-bit RISC core operating at a frequency of up to 36 MHz. Its robust architecture, enhanced peripherals, and low power consumption make it ideal for a variety of applications including industrial control, medical equipment, and consumer electronics.
Key Features
- Core: ARM® Cortex®-M3 32-bit RISC core operating at a 36 MHz maximum frequency.
- Memory: Comes with 16 Kbytes of Flash memory and 4 Kbytes of SRAM, providing ample storage for instructions and operational data.
- Debugging: Integrated debug mode supports development, with serial wire debug (SWD) and JTAG interfaces.
- Performance: Single-cycle multiplication and hardware division, enhancing the processing capability.
- Power Efficiency: Features three low-power modes (Sleep, Stop, and Standby) to optimize power consumption according to the application's needs.
- I/Os: Up to 37 I/O pins, each of which is 5V-tolerant and has high sink/source current capabilities.
- Communication Interfaces: Includes I2C, SPI, and USARTs, which can serve a variety of communication protocols.
- Timers: Advanced-control timer, general-purpose timers, basic timer, and a watchdog timer to manage timing tasks.
- Analog: Offers up to 10-channel 12-bit ADC, ensuring accurate analog signal acquisition.
- Supply Voltage: Can be powered by a supply voltage ranging from 2.0 to 3.6V, suitable for battery-powered and portable applications.
- Package: Available in a 64-pin LQFP package, which provides a compact footprint while allowing for sufficient I/O and peripheral connectivity.
